The minimum gross annual salary for this position starts from € 45.080 per year (full-time) according to the classification in the collective bargaining agreement for the pharmaceutical industry. Depending on professional experience and qualifications, we offer overpayment. We offer a comprehensive benefits package including flexible working hours, a fully subsidised Klimaticket for public transportation, a meal allowance, and extensive group health insurance coverage

We’re not your typical healthcare company. In a modern world of quick fixes, we focus on solutions to defeat serious chronic disease and create long-term health.
Our unordinary mindset is at the heart of everything we do. We seek out new ideas and put people first as we push the boundaries of science, make healthcare more accessible, and work to treat, prevent, and even cure diseases that affect millions of lives. Founded in Denmark in 1923, today we employ more than 77,000 people in 80 offices around the world – all united by our bold purpose to drive change to defeat serious chronic diseases.
